Unlocking Scientific Potential: The Essential Laboratory Equipment Every Researcher Needs

Understanding the Importance of Laboratory Equipment

In the ever-evolving field of science, having the right tools is vital for successful experimentation and research. Well-equipped laboratories not only facilitate discovery but also ensure that scientific endeavors are conducted safely and efficiently. Here’s a look at essential laboratory equipment that every researcher and educator should consider.

Must-Have Laboratory Equipment

  • Microscopes: Integral for observing small samples, microscopes allow researchers to see fine details that are invisible to the naked eye. Different types, such as light, electron, and fluorescence microscopes, serve various scientific needs.
  • Centrifuges: Essential for separating components in liquids, centrifuges are widely used in biology and chemistry labs. By spinning samples at high speeds, they enable effective separation of particles based on density.
  • Pipettes: Precision in measurement is crucial in any scientific work. Pipettes assist in transferring small volumes of liquids accurately, making them indispensable for experiments.
  • Fume Hoods: Safety is paramount in any laboratory. Fume hoods protect users from hazardous vapors, ensuring a safe working environment while handling volatile substances.
  • Refrigerators and Freezers: Many biological samples and chemicals need to be stored at specific temperatures. These appliances help in preserving the integrity of these materials.

Educational Materials to Enhance Learning

In addition to equipment, educational materials play a crucial role in advancing scientific knowledge. Here are some key resources:

  • Laboratory Manuals: Comprehensive guides that provide step-by-step instructions for experiments are invaluable to students and novice researchers.
  • Interactive Software: Virtual labs and simulation software help learners understand complex concepts and practice skills without the need for physical equipment.
  • Science Kits: These kits often contain experiments and projects that encourage hands-on learning and reinforce theoretical knowledge.

Investing in Quality Chemicals

High-quality chemicals are essential for accurate results in any scientific experiment. Always source chemicals from reputable suppliers to ensure:

  • Purity: High-purity chemicals reduce contamination and yield reliable results.
  • Consistent Performance: Reliable suppliers provide chemicals with consistent batch attributes, crucial for repeat experiments.
  • Safety Information: Quality suppliers offer detailed documentation on safety and handling, which is critical for regulatory compliance and user safety.
